Description
Operating in neighbourhood coffeeshops (Yishun and Bedok) ensures consistent daily footfall, repeat customers, and demand that is less affected by economic cycles.
✅ Resilient, Multi-Cuisine Concept
The business serves everyday food concept (Western, Thai, Malay and local Dim Sum), diversifying revenue streams and reducing reliance on a single food trend. This makes the business proven and resilient across different customer segments.
✅ Strong Early Performance
• ~S$500,000 revenue achieved within 6 months of opening (3 stores opened since June 25)
• Operations have stabilised with trained foreign staff in place (investor can take passive role for day-to-day operations)
• Smooth takeover with minimal disruption
✅ Low & Favourable Rent
• Only ~S$7,000/month for all 3 stores combined
• Located in neighbourhood estates, keeping costs low and margins defensible
✅ Fully Set Up – No Further Capex Required
• Over S$100,000 spent on renovations and equipment
• Fully fitted kitchens and ready-to-operate outlets
• Immediate continuation of operations
✅ Turnkey with Staff Ready
• Staff are trained and operational (monthly salary of 6 full-time staff < 10k)
• SOPs, suppliers, recipe and daily workflow already established
• Suitable for owner-operator or investor with management team
